Introduction to Hyper Casual Games
You have probably come across an ad in a game that pops up and shows you a simple game that you can play by only tapping on the screen or swiping left or right. You guessed it right. That was a hyper-casual game. In the mobile gaming industry, this genre is described as fun, addictive, and simple games that can attract non-gamers to play this game. In fact, the mechanism that lies in the games is more inclined to getting players attention so that they can spend more time on them. Mobile gaming has been taken over by hyper-casual games because of the easy-to-learn playstyle and addictive nature. If you are a commuter or you are on your break time, this type of game offers an interesting and stunning experience and drives you to a world of entertainment without you knowing.
Compared to complex and immersive genres in the mobile gaming market, hyper-casual games also have its own features such as leaderboard, level up progression, and competitive nature which let players to have challenging gameplays and how to improve themselves as well. Selection Criteria
There are so many reasons for playing any game in the mobile gaming world. Hyper-casual games are no exception. Main reasons that give superiority to this genre in order to satisfy your needs lies in this section:
- Short playtime: One of the main reasons hyper-casual games in mobile gaming markets are far better than other genres in the mobile gaming industry is the fact that they let players spend their time less on learning tutorials and complex game sessions which is time-consuming and they lose interest in having this type of genre in their smartphones.
- Wider audience: The sole purpose of this genre in mobile gaming is to bring more people towards itself. Any complex backgrounds and themes might lose this aim and desert non-gamers as well. So, avoiding these factors can be effective to attract a larger audience.
- Mobile optimization: This genre came to exist in the mobile gaming industry solely. Moreover, optimizations in smartphones must go around the adaptations to any size of phones and tablets and customising the touch screen along with the low-end smartphones as well.
- Monetization system: Since hyper-casual games in mobile gaming are free-to-play, there has to be a system of profiting for further improvements in the games themselves. There are optional ways which are either in-app purchases or ads that give players rewards for watching.
- Visualisation: Although this genre in mobile gaming includes more simple visuals, it must have an eye-catching, pleasant, and satisfying experience and graphics so that it brings more players to have hyper-casual games in their library.

Quick and Easy Gameplay with Addictive Challenges
Specifically speaking, hyper-casual games in mobile gaming stores are intended to be simple which let players login to the game so easily. Without any specific knowledge, you can tap, swipe, and drag anywhere on the screen. Avoiding any necessary complexity is the main goal of this genre in mobile gaming markets which provides an enjoyable gaming experience for players of all ages and any skill levels. Hyper-casual games are developed to shorten the duration of time in every session which allows players to avoid any complicated tutorials and play them instantly.
Addictive challenges come in various forms. It can be providing a leaderboard, optimal levels of difficulty, or showing the results after the gameplay. What is more important about the hyper-casual games in the mobile gaming market is the fact that easy gameplay always brings addictiveness towards a player. It is rooted more in excitement, enthusiasm, and the desire to play hours in a single game. Even more, beating a friend's high score makes it more satisfying for someone to help them stay in the game.
Minimalistic Design and Social Integrations
One of the reasons that can attract more people towards this genre in the mobile gaming industry is the minimalistic factors. Having a clear and clean user interface (UI), simple backgrounds and graphics, and using whitespaces are considered to be the factors that help hyper-casual games to be more minimalistic which creates a friendly environment for players to enjoy the gaming experiences. While multiplayer gameplay, having a global chat, team up with friends, send and receive gifts, and login to the game via social media accounts such as Facebook or Google will enhance the gaming experience as the main factors in social integrations.
The Best Picks of Hyper-Casual Games
Fast-growing markets in mobile gaming always create new and top games for people of all ages. Here are top 5 hyper-casual games:
- Subway Surfers: An endless runner tries to run away from the gruesome police officer. You should tap or click and swipe up and down to pass the obstacles so that you will not get caught by your enemy. Subway Surfers can be downloaded on Google Play Store or GameLoop.
- Magic Tiles 3: This hyper-casual game lets you play piano and other top music by just tapping on the black tiles. Magic Tiles 3 is considered to be the most popular musical game among people.
- Bridge Race: As the name suggests Bridge Race lets you make bridges with collectible blocks with 1000 levels. This game has been downloaded more than 100M on Google Play Store.
- Going Balls: This 1000 levels’ game lets you lead the metal ball through the wooden rails which makes it addictive by passing through the difficult levels. Going Balls is one of those hyper-casual games that makes you busy by playing many hours in a day.
- DOP 4: Draw One Part: One of the most simplistic hyper-casual games that lets you guess the pictures created by other players is DOP 4. It has been said before that having a white space background makes the game more minimalistic and simpler which this game holds to it.
